Description
The Walled Garden at Calderhaugh House, located on Calderhaugh Lane in Lochwinnoch, dates from the late 18th century. It features a two-storey, three-bay classical house characterized by a pedimented central bay. The building is constructed of coursed rubble with ashlar margins. It has a central, recessed door that includes a fanlight and ogival reveals in the architraves, topped with a cornice. The windows are 12-pane sashes, and there is an eaves course and cornice, along with an oculus in the pediment. The house displays scrolled skewputts, straight skews, corniced end stacks, and a slate roof.
To the southeast, there is an L-plan stable block made of rubble with ashlar margins, featuring segmental-headed and rectangular carriage openings, and a partly holed slate roof. A rubble wall extends southwest from the house, providing access to a Japanese Garden through a circular opening adorned with rendered voissoirs. The keystone of this opening is decorated with an elephant on the southeast face and a cockerel on the northwest face. Within the garden, there are elaborate Oriental-style wells, a fountain, and tables, as well as corniced square gatepiers.
